Land Use Policy Group

The group, known as the Land Use Policy Group, or simply LUPG, consists of the appropriate policy directors in each of the statutory agencies, supported by two officer groups – the Rural Affairs Group (RAG) dealing primarily with agricultural issues and the Woodland Policy Group (WPG) dealing primarily with forestry issues. RAG and WPG have day to day responsibility for the work and each agency has allocated staff time and money.
By working together, the agencies aim to collaborate on research to inform policy, and to maximise our influence on the policy debate, putting forward common views where possible on key issues.
